Why Retensive exists

Acquisition got the tooling. The audience you own got a send button.

Everyone knows the math: acquiring a customer costs multiples of keeping one, and the price of the next click only goes up. Yet the tooling gap runs the other way. Acquisition gets attribution platforms, bidding algorithms, and creative testing at industrial scale. The audience you already paid to build gets a tool for composing a message and sending it to a list.

We've run those sends. We've managed the suppression spreadsheets, warmed the domains by hand, watched a reputation problem show up in the metrics a day too late, and explained to a CFO why “open rate” was the best number we had. The part between the segment and the inbox — where owned-audience revenue is actually won or lost — has been an afterthought for twenty years.

Retensive is our answer: one system where understanding the audience, finding the revenue pockets, activating them with control, and measuring what moved the business are connected. Where deliverability is an input to planning, not a post-mortem. Where the metric that matters is revenue from the audience you already own.
